Understanding Legal Rights
Comprehending your lawful rights is critical when browsing the intricacies of the lawful system. Understanding what you're entitled to under the law can significantly affect the end result of your case. You're not simply a spectator in your lawful battles; you're an energetic participant with legal rights that protect you.
To start with, you can remain quiet. This isn't simply a line in movies; it's your shield versus self-incrimination. Whatever you say can certainly be used against you, so understanding the power of silence is critical.
You also deserve to be stood for by a lawyer. Whether you employ one or have one assigned, lawful representation is your fundamental right. It ensures you have a professional to browse the legal ins and outs and supporter in your place.
Furthermore, you're entitled to a fair trial. This implies being tried in a proficient court, by an impartial jury, and without excessive delay. You likewise deserve to confront witnesses versus you, which allows your protection to cross-examine the prosecution's witnesses and test their statement.
Identifying these legal rights equips you to take an energetic function in your protection and helps secure your liberty and future.

Trial Preparation and Depiction
After discovering protection methods, it is very important to focus on how your lawyer will get ready for trial and represent you in court. Your legal representative's duty changes significantly as they move from intending to activity.
Initially, they'll collect and evaluate all evidence, guaranteeing they recognize the case inside out. This includes depositions, witness declarations, and any physical evidence that could affect your trial.
Next, your lawyer will establish a compelling narrative. They'll craft a tale that straightens with the evidence but also humanizes you to the jury. This narrative is critical; it's the foundation of your protection, created to resonate with jurors' feelings and logic.
Mock tests could be conducted to refine disagreements and prepare for prosecution tactics. Your lawyer will certainly likewise determine whether you must indicate, which can be a pivotal choice in your situation.
Throughout the actual test, anticipate your lawyer to be assertive. They'll test inconsistencies in the prosecution's evidence and cross-examine witnesses to highlight uncertainties about their dependability or integrity.
